Description
Kelutah in מי חטאת, Zevachim 93a; Mishnah Parah 10:5, Rambam and Rash Mishantz; Tosafot Yom Tov's question on Rambam; Tosefta and Gra's interpretation; is this is special din in mei chatat- Rashi Zevachim, Rambam and Rash Mishantz Parah 10:3; Kelutah in Gittin 79a; Yerushalmi's distinction betweeen Shabbat and Gitting; Ritva's interpretation; Kelutah for Kinyanim- Bava Kama 70b; Distinctions between Kelutah in Kinyanim and Shabbat: Rashi (BK and Gittin), Tosafot BK, Rambam's position on סופו לנוח; Restriction on Kelutah in Shabbat- Ramban 4a, 5b, Tosafot 4a and 92a, Tosafot Yeshanim 4b, Rashba and Ritva 5b; the role of kavanah in keluta- Rashba 98a, Tosafot Eruvin 98a, Meiri Shabbat 4b.
